Global Warming Reveals Hidden Treasures
The rapid melting of glaciers worldwide due to global warming has unearthed mysterious objects that intrigue scientists. Archaeologists are flocking to regions where melting glaciers reveal strange artifacts, tools, statues, and human remains.
Uncovering Ancient Trade Routes
Archaeologists in Norway have discovered over 4,500 artifacts from the melting glaciers, shedding light on ancient trade routes and professions.
Unique Discoveries
Recent findings, such as a 1700-year-old horse's hoof and well-preserved tools, have astonished researchers.
Preserved Artifacts
Items found, including gloves and tools, provide insights into ancient cultures and activities, with some objects dating back centuries.
Excitement Among Scientists
Archaeologists describe the region of Lendbreen as a treasure trove, with Viking-era artifacts and medieval trade routes being exposed due to rapid melting.
Rare Finds
Discoveries like well-preserved arrows made from reindeer antler shed light on past societies and long-distance trade networks.
Challenges Ahead
The arrival of winter poses challenges for further exploration, but researchers eagerly await the next melting season for more exciting discoveries.
